- Set Realistic Expectations:
Slot games are based on chance, and wins are unpredictable. Setting realistic expectations is crucial to managing emotions. Understand that winning or losing streaks are normal and that no guarantee of consistent wins exists. By being realistic and approaching the game with a balanced mindset, you can avoid feelings of disappointment or frustration if luck doesn’t go your way.
- Practice Responsible Bankroll Management:
Effective bankroll management is vital in maintaining emotional balance while playing slot games. Set a budget for each session and stick to it. Avoid chasing losses or wagering more than you can comfortably afford to lose. Playing within your means alleviates the stress and anxiety associated with financial losses and promotes a calmer mindset during gameplay.
- Take Breaks and Set Time Limits:
Excessive gameplay can lead to heightened emotions and potential burnout. Set time limits for your slot game sessions and take regular breaks. Stepping away from the game allows you to regain perspective, recharge, and prevent emotional fatigue. Use this time to engage in other activities, spend time with loved ones, or pursue hobbies to maintain a balanced lifestyle.
